Cat-scratch disease (CSD) is a mild bacterial infection spread through scratches or bites from infected cats or kittens, or exposure to cat fleas. The bacteria, Bartonella henselae, can also be transmitted through contact with infected cat saliva on broken skin or mucosal surfaces like the eyes, nose, or mouth.
